Hi everyone!  I have been up to my eyes in swatching lately, so it was so nice to take a break and get back to nail art!  I decided on a skittle design for my Valentine's Day mani this year!



I started off with (from index to pinky) two coats of Delush Polish Je Ne Sais Quoi, three coats of Nicole by OPI Sweet Surrender, two coats of Zoya Mira, and two coats of China Glaze Wish on a Starfish.  I followed with one coat of SV, with the exception of Wish on a Starfish.



I used my striping tape to create the envelope outlines over Mira, and applied one coat of Nicole by OPI Yoga-Then-Yogurt.  I removed the tape immediately and followed with one coat of SV.



For a little bit of glitz, I used some pink hex glequins in a polka dot pattern over Sweet Surrender, and sealed them with one coat of SV.

To seal the envelope with a heart, I fished out a red holographic heart from Pretty & Polished Be-Claus I Love You, and finished with one coat of SV.

I absolutely love the end result!  It has a bit of flair, but is still on the delicate side!
